1. Overview

The University of Delhi’s Faculty of Medical Sciences is one of India’s leading medical education institutions. It was founded in 1951 with the mission of providing high-quality medical and healthcare education and training. The faculty is committed to improving healthcare services, expanding medical knowledge, and contributing to the community’s overall health. Because it is associated with a number of well-known hospitals, it offers students numerous opportunities for practical training and clinical experience.

 

2. Programs Offered

The Faculty of Medical Sciences offers a number of undergraduate and graduate programs that aim to give students a complete understanding of medicine and the skills to practice it:

Courses for Undergraduates:

MBBS: The flagship program is the Bachelor of Medicine and Surgery (MBBS) program, which takes five and a half years to complete and requires a one-year rotating internship. The objective of the curriculum is to provide students with a solid foundation in clinical skills, patient care, and medical sciences.
Programs for Graduates:

MD/MS: Multiple Master of Surgery (MS) and Doctor of Medicine (MD) specializations are offered by the Faculty. Graduates of these programs are prepared for advanced clinical practice, research, and teaching through in-depth study of specific areas of medicine and surgery.
Degree Programs: There are a number of diploma programs available for graduates looking to improve their credentials in fields like dermatology, OB/GYN, and pediatrics.
Specialized Courses: In addition, the Faculty offers Super Specialty programs (DM/MCh) for individuals who wish to further their expertise and career prospects by pursuing advanced studies in specialized fields.

10. Admissions Procedure

The Faculty of Medical Sciences’ admissions procedure aims to select qualified applicants for the following programs:

For MD: The National Testing Agency’s National Eligibility and Entrance Examination (NEET) serves as the basis for admissions. Candidates must meet the college’s eligibility requirements and have completed their 10+2 education with Science subjects (Physics, Chemistry, and Biology).

MD and MS: For admission to postgraduate programs, applicants must have a MBBS degree and pass the NEET PG exam. The university typically conducts NEET PG-based counseling as part of the selection process.

Courses with Super Specialties: For Super Specialty courses (DM/MCh), candidates must have an MD or MS degree and pass the respective entrance examination.
